Crunchy Chilli Baby Corn Skewers

The crispiness is achieved by double frying the baby corns and you can obtain the crunchy munchiness. INGREDIENTS

  • 1 pack Baby Corn
  • 2 tbsp All-Purpose Flour
  • 1½ teaspoon Corn Flour
  • Salt
  • Water
  • 1 tbsp Sesame Seeds (roasted)
  • 1 tbsp Vegetable Oil
  • 1 tsp Garlic (chopped)
  • 2 Green Chilis 
  • 1 tsp Spring Onion
  • 2 tbsp Ketchup
  • 2 tsp Soy Sauce
  • 1/2 tsp green chilli paste 

IN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Boil or steam the baby corn for 2 minutes.
  2. Mix All-Purpose Flour, Corn Flour, Salt, and Water and make a loose batter.
  3. Heat oil in a small deep pan and deep fry the baby corn by dipping in the batter. After 5 minutes, double fry the baby corn if you want it crispier. 
  4. In a separate pan, pour in the oil and add in the garlic and green chillis and saute till the raw smell disappears.
  5. Mix in the sauces and sautee for a minute. Add the fried baby corn to the pan and sautee till the sauces get covered in the sauce and immediately transfer to a serving dish.
  6. Push in Skewers onto the baby corn lengthwise. Garnish with spring onions and sesame seeds.
